Iran Ready for Oil Sale to Belarus: Larijani

TEHRAN (Tasnim) – Iran's Parliament Speaker Ali Larijani voiced the country’ preparedness to sell crude oil to Belarus.

Iran is ready for selling oil to Belarus, Larijani said at a meeting with speaker of the Council of the Republic of Belarus, Mikhail Myasnikovich, held in Tehran on Monday.

Highlighting Tehran’s resolve to forge closer trade ties with Minsk, the Iranian speaker noted that parliamentary friendship groups can contribute to the enhancement of scientific, technical and academic collaboration between the two sides.

For his part, Myasnikovich described Iran as a “key partner” for Belarus, calling for political and parliamentary efforts to strengthen bilateral relations.

Iran and Belarus have developed good relations in recent years, particularly in the economic and trade sectors, and have signed a number of agreements to boost cooperation.

In May 2016, Belarusian Prime Minister Andrei Kobyakov voiced his country’s willingness to develop bilateral relations with Iran in various economic and political areas.

Later in 2016, Deputy Prime Minister of Belarus Vladimir Semashko unveiled plans for the sale of electric buses to Iran.
